Laser etching was done with a HL40-5g Full Range Laser LLC, a 40W CO2 laser glass strip cutter engraving platform operating at 1000ppi resolution in raster setting. In order to solely remove the NC membrane layer, while reducing damage of the membrane layer itself and the support, various resolutions and also laser power setups were tested. Since processing speed is paramount for large-scale handling, we only operated the system at 100% laser rate and it was figured out that a laser power of 40% at 1000 ppi achieved the purpose.

If the target analyte is present in the example, the analyte will bind to the antibodies on the nanoparticle surface area and prevent the nanoparticle from binding to the examination line. This will decrease the signal at the test line leading to a signal intensity that is vice versa symmetrical to the amount of analyte existing in the sample. The results from a side circulation test can be either qualitative (" yes/no"), semi-quantitative, or quantitative. The pregnancy examination is an instance of a qualitative yes/no assay, where a favorable test line signal correlates to raised degrees of the hCG hormonal agent in pee, showing that the individual is expectant. For quantitative diagnostics, the examination line intensities are contrasted to a calibration requirement and also converted to an analyte concentration value. To properly measure the examination line intensity, the LFA outcome have to be assessed by a strip visitor.
